Alloc: Perhaps old SWT binaries have been extracted to your ~/.eclipse, try
running:
find ~/.eclipse -name '*.so'
If it lists any swt libraries, then your ~/.eclipse is tainted. The
crashes are then likely to be caused by these libraries being outdated
and the only known solution is to remove your ~/.eclipse.
If this is not the case (or removing your ~/.eclipse does not help), please run:
apport-collect 563647
